About the Role
As an Analytics Engineer in Safety Systems, you will play a pivotal role in building a data-centric culture, enhancing decision-making processes, and driving strategic initiatives through analytics. You will partner closely with Engineering, Research, and Data Science to develop and maintain canonical data sources and source-of-truth dashboards that enable both people and AI agents across the organization to derive trustworthy, actionable insights.
You will own the consumption layer for safety metrics: defining intuitive, reliable ways for stakeholders across Safety Systems, partner teams, and leadership to understand the safety of our products, answer safety-related questions independently, and inform product decisions and company strategy.
Most importantly, you will be a core member of the Safety Systems team, collaborating with researchers and engineers to advance our goals of safe, robust, and reliable AI.
This role is based in San Francisco, CA. We use a hybrid work model of 3 days in the office per week and offer relocation assistance to new employees.
In this role, you will:
Design and maintain canonical datasets that serve as sources of truth for safety metrics.
Develop and refine data products such as dashboards, reports, agent-enabled workflows, and machine-readable interfaces that empower stakeholders to extract and analyze data independently.
Work closely with stakeholders in Engineering, Research, and Data Science to understand their decision-making needs and design intuitive ways to consume complex safety metrics, including dashboards, reports, agentic workflows and other data products.
Ensure that analytics and visualizations are both accurate and user-friendly, incorporating user experience principles.
Advocate for data quality, consistency, and reliability across analytics products.

About UI Design
The User Interface (UI) Design area focuses on creating and designing all the visual elements that users interact with in a digital product. This includes screens, buttons, icons, typography, color palettes, and responsive layouts, ensuring an aesthetically pleasing, consistent, and easy-to-use interface. Skills in tools like Figma and knowledge of design systems are essential.

About Automation Analyst
The Automation Analyst is the professional responsible for identifying process optimization opportunities and developing automated workflows (RPA, scripts, or integrations). They map manual and repetitive tasks across various company areas and build automation solutions using low-code/no-code platforms (such as Zapier, Make, Power Automate, n8n) or RPA tools (such as UiPath), driving operational efficiency and error reduction.
